About The Position

The Associate Director for Student Transitions and Family Engagement plays a central role in advancing the mission of the Office of Student Transitions and Family Engagement. The Associate Director reports to the Director of Student Transitions and Family Engagement and operates within the Division of Student Life. The Associate Director leads operational coordination for orientation and transition programs and support for family engagement init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Design, provide direction for, and implement orientation programs (summer, August, January) for more than 4,000 first-year students, 300 transfer students, and more than 5,000 family members.
  • Partner with the Director and lead the Assistant Directors in planning and executing office-wide programs such as orientation, Welcome Weekend, First 50 Days, and Family Weekend.
  • Foster campus partnerships and lead orientation planning groups with key university partners.
  • Coordinate all aspects of orientation programs including staffing, program development, logistics, and implementation.
  • Provide primary supervision, leadership, and professional development for Orientation Student Coordinators and Student Orientation Undergraduate Leaders (SOULs).
  • Design, implement, assess, and evaluate training and development programs for Orientation Student Coordinators and Student Orientation Undergraduate Leaders (SOULs).
  • Manage print, electronic, and social media communications including email, newsletters, social media, promotional materials, and printed resources for new students and family members.
  • Teach section(s) of the one-credit University 101 courses for new first-year and/or transfer students to support student transition and engagement.
  • Assist with developing and conducting office assessments and analyzing assessment data.
  • Assist with course implementation, enrollment, and instructor support for first-year experience courses (e.g. UNV 101).
  • Provide direction and support for transition initiatives, including Welcome Weekend, First 50 Days programs, and Miami Bound pre-semester programs.
  • As needed/required, supervise graduate, temporary, or practicum staff members.
  • Represent the office on divisional and institutional committees and contribute to professional association engagement.
  • Represent the office in the absence of the Director.
